Providence City Council approves hazard mitigation plan during brief special meeting

The Providence City Council passed a hazard mitigation plan for the coming year by voice vote at a special meeting Jan. 30, 2025, after taking several procedural waivers. The meeting recorded nine members present and featured no substantive debate on the plan at that session.

The Providence City Council approved a hazard mitigation plan for the coming year during a brief special meeting on Jan. 30, 2025, passing the item on a voice vote.
The meeting was largely procedural: the council recorded nine members present and six absent, waived the invocation and pledge, waived the reading of agenda items 1 and 2 (which were noted as received), and then moved to item 3. A motion "to waive the read of item 3 and pass on a voice vote" was made and seconded and the chair declared the motion passed after asking for abstentions.
Council members did not engage in substantive debate on the text of the hazard mitigation plan during this meeting; no amendments or detailed discussion of plan provisions is recorded in the meeting transcript. The actions taken at the Jan. 30 special meeting were procedural approvals and a voice vote to adopt item 3 as presented on the agenda.
Votes at a glance: Waiver of invocation and pledge — motion made and seconded; passed by voice vote. Waiver of reading of items 1 and 2 — motion made and seconded; items 1 and 2 were noted as received and the motion passed by voice vote. Item 3 (hazard mitigation plan for the coming year) — motion to waive the reading and pass on a voice vote; motion passed. Motion to adjourn — passed by voice vote.
The council invited those who could remain to attend a council-as-a-whole meeting later the same day, at which a special guest was scheduled for 5:30 p.m.
